Job description

CDAC is seeking master's level clinicians to deliver counseling services to students in a public-school setting to build resiliency in youth facing multiple risk factors, so they may lead healthy, productive, drug and violence free lives. The counselor works to provide individual and/or group support to students using evidence-based curricula and counseling theories and techniques.

  • The positions require a Master's Degree in Psychology, Counseling, or Social Work with individual and group support services/counseling experience, preferably within a school-based setting.
  • This is a permanent full-time position with a 10-month schedule (191-days), which follows the school calendar.
  • School holidays and breaks are observed, including summer break.
  • The salary is $36,000 annually, based on the 10-month schedule.
  • You will not need to reapply each year to continue employment.

This permanent 10-month position includes a competitive comprehensive benefit package including, but not limited to: health, dental, vision, life and long-term disability insurance, as well as a 401(k) plan.
